Game Recap

On Thursday night, the Boston Red Sox defeated the New York Yankees 15-7 after rallying from an early deficit. Steve Pearce was a key contributor, hitting three home runs in the game. His second homer was a three-run blast during Boston's dominant eight-run fourth inning. This decisive victory extended the Red Sox's lead in the AL East standings to a season-high six and a half games.
